|
|
Другие темы раздела | ||||||||||||||||||
ATmega AVR ISR в отдельном модуле Как из main-программы перенести ISR в другой модуль (библиотеку)? AVR-GCC. Пока приходится костылем: в модуле void isr_foo(void) { ... } В main.c: ISR(FOO) { isr_foo(); } https://www.cyberforum.ru/ avr/ thread2086274.html |
AVRStudio ругается на u08 вместо char? ATmega AVR Здравствуйте! Начал использовать AVRStudyo 4.19+AVRToolchain 3.4.2 вместо CVAVR, при переносе частично написанной программы хотел использовать u08 вместо char, но AVRStudyo почему то сильно ругается warningами, а иногда даже errorами, кричит о несовместимости. Пришлось окатиться. По чужим листингам, я вижу, что народ очень активно использует u08. Подскажите, пожалуйста, в каком направлении мне... | |||||||||||||||||
ATmega AVR Затер bootloader в atmega16u4 Для того, чтобы можно было воспользоваться ISP-программатором , чип пришлось стереть, что полностью уничтожило Flip-boottooder для моей Atmega16u4. Знаю точно, что на сайте атмела должен хранится бинарник на мою атмегу. Но разобраться в англоязычных дебрях я не смог. Если у кого-то есть бинарник бутлоадера скинте на мыло zamki74(гав-гав)bk.ru или дайте ссылку на скачивание. https://www.cyberforum.ru/ avr/ thread2086272.html |
ATmega AVR Как бы обыграть конфликт ds18b20 на пине SS?
https://www.cyberforum.ru/ avr/ thread2086271.html угораздило меня подключить ds18b20 на PB2 atmega8a к SPI у меня подключен радио модуль nrf24l01+ оно у меня работало пока я использовал библиотеку для радио с софтверным SPI но опыт с этой библиотекой по адекватности работы радио не удачный переключился на другую в которой железный SPI и обнаружил, что температура у меня перестала измеряться только сейчас до меня дошло, что хоть SS... | |||||||||||||||||
ATmega AVR Студия Чего за прикол такой в дизассемблере? Пустые строчки начиная с 0х40 и так до определенного адреса (хотя код там еще определенно есть,видно в програм-мемори) ?И так кусками показывает. Почему так? <Изображение удалено> |
ATmega AVR Осциллограф на Atmega 8
https://www.cyberforum.ru/ avr/ thread2086269.html Все доброго дня. Решил я по этой статье собрать осциллограф. Мегу взял в дип корпусе. Вытравил плату, собрал данный девайс, а он нихрена не работает :( Дисплей абсолютно ничего не отображает, но если коснуться пальцем земляного полигона, в нижнем углу дисплея появляется какой-то мусор. Схему нарисовал и перевел в плату в программе Diptrosi. Если кто посмотрит на плату (мож я где накосячил),... | |||||||||||||||||
ATmega AVR таблицы выбора Атмелов Компания Rainbow Teknologis (я скопировал ее название из официального письма :) любезно предоставила удобную параметрическую таблицу в формате Exel, а так же в растровом формате .png, для печати на принтере. Так как никто не оговаривал приватности этой инфы, а она сама по себе показалась мне удобной, то выкладываю здесь образец (один из .png-файлов), а все остальное в виде архива (1,5... https://www.cyberforum.ru/ avr/ thread2086268.html |
RTC на mega8 с часовым кварцем ATmega AVR прошелся по форуму поиском, прямого ответа не нашел до этого искал гуглом - выяснил две вещи: - часовой кварц капризен, желательны конденсаторы внешние, пайка максимально близко к выводам МК, заземление корпуса - таймер в асинхронном режиме нужно инициализировать в порядке описанном в отдельной главе даташита все это сделал, правда тестирую пока на макетке - корпус заземлил, но... | |||||||||||||||||
ATmega AVR Несколько двойных кнопок на одно прерывание Возникла необходимость подключить несколько кнопок, а прерываний мало и они нужны будут в другом месте. Обратил внимание, что почти все миниатюрные кнопочки имеют в своём составе 4 ноги, может для устойчивости но скорее всего там 2 независимые кнопки. Схема такая, половинки всех кнопок подключаются параллельно и заводятся на пин с прерыванием, другие половины в обычные порты или другими... https://www.cyberforum.ru/ avr/ thread2086266.html |
ATmega AVR новая atmega328p-pu прошивка бутлодера
https://www.cyberforum.ru/ avr/ thread2086265.html добрый день, все по порядку запускаю новые процессоры Atmega 328P-PU ### 1. собираю схему "ардуина в минимальной обвеске", схему пока не привожу, их в инете полно и все они как близнецы...(кварц 20Мгц, емкости 22пф, резистор на сброс, светодиод итд...) ### 2. тестовыя программи "блинк", работает нормально main.c #include <avr/io.h> | |||||||||||||||||
ATmega AVR Как глюк поймать с переферией SPI? Делаю для автоматизации ряд устройств - их общая черта это связь с контроллером умного дома через радио модули с чипами nrf24 Сейчас отлаживаю очередное устройство - оно считает расход воды со счетчиков, замеряет температуру ds18b20, имеет два входа с передачей на контроллер по радио и 5 выходов с управлением из консоли умного дома Написал весь функционал - работает шикарно. Но... Поработает... |
ATmega AVR UART - разные частоты узлов
https://www.cyberforum.ru/ avr/ thread2086263.html Два девайса, оба на atmega16a. Одно тактируется внутренним осцилятором на 8МГц, второе - внутренним 1МГц. Обмен по UART через RS485. Один только передает, второй только принимает. Глючит. Каждая четвертая-шестая восьмибайтовая посылка приходит с ошибками в отдельных битах. Температурные и прочие
Наверх
|